According to you, high and low grades are not changed occasionally. First of all, you should check the cylinder change behind the gearbox and hang the cylinder head at low speed to see if there is any air leakage. If there is air leakage, it means that the O-ring of the cylinder is worn, and replacement will solve the problem. If it doesn't leak, you need to see where it leaks. Replace the valve if it leaks. Another problem is that the weather is relatively cold recently. In the morning, due to the low temperature, the O-ring in the auxiliary box cylinder is rubber, which will expand with heat and contract with cold, resulting in air leakage in the cylinder, and the air pressure is not enough to push the cylinder. Scald it with hot water and the problem will be solved.
